I'm using one right now and it shows as Standard 101/102-Key or Microsoft
Natural PS/2 Keyboard. Are you hooked up via PS/2 or are you using a USB
adapter?

The MS Natural Keyboard Elite uses the built in drivers for keyboards that
should be provided by Windows XP.

It is no different than any other normal keyboard.
